No outwardly obvious signs of celebrating anything here just now. Huge winds, over 250mm (10") of rain in less than 24hrs. Last week, so dry I had to buy water. This week we are flooded in. Tanks are very much full, as of this morning. Dam that was almost dry thursday, is about to hit 100% capacity within next hour, then the excess flows out and adds to the flooding elsewhere. And flooding there is!!! Can go less than a kilometer in any direction. Further north, Rockhampton badly flooded. Tornadoes (said to be three in total) went through Bundaberg this afternoon, with severe damage in its path. Very high winds here. So high I can't get to the workshop without being water blasted! I'm not up for that. Brisbane expecting their share of flooding rains tomorrow, courtesy of rain overnight. They are about 200km south of here, so we will know about the rough stuff well before it gets down their way.

Radio tells us the heavy rain and bad winds arrive overnight tonight! Jeeezus! This is the entree, main course yet to come. I have never seen the wind this bad, ever. Even the dog won't come out of her house.
